Quick Summary
The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Aviation at Philadelphia, PA has issued a Presolicitation notice for DAMPER ASSY (NSN 7R-1615-016047562-BL), quantity 39 EA. This is an intent to award a sole-source contract under FAR 6.302-1 due to engineering source approval requirements for this flight-critical item. Interested parties must demonstrate capability and source approval within 45 days of the synopsis publication date (May 5, 2026).
Scope of Work
Acquisition of 39 EA of DAMPER ASSY, NSN 7R-1615-016047562-BL, REF NR 70106-28000-049. Delivery is FOB Origin. This item is flight-critical and requires engineering source approval by the design control activity to maintain quality. The Government intends to solicit and negotiate with only previously approved sources due to proprietary data rights, manufacturing knowledge, and technical data not economically available to the Government.

Evaluation
This is not a request for competitive proposals. However, all responsible sources may identify their interest and capability or submit proposals/capability statements within 45 days of publication. New sources must qualify in accordance with the design control activity's procedures, as approved by the cognizant Government engineering activity. Offers from unapproved sources must include detailed information as per NAVSUP Weapon Systems Support (NAVSUP WSS) Source Approval Information Brochures (links provided in the original notice). Failure to provide required data will result in non-consideration for award.
Additional Notes
The Government is not using FAR Part 12 (Acquisition of Commercial Items) policies. Interested persons may identify their capability to satisfy the requirement with a commercial item within 15 days of this notice. Drawings are not available. Contact AISHA J. VARNADORE for inquiries.
